  1. [verb] kill by squeezing the throat of so as to cut off the air; "he tried to strangle his opponent"; "A man in Boston has been strangling several dozen prostitutes"
    Synonyms: strangle, throttle

  2. [verb] constrict a hollow organ or vessel so as to stop the flow of blood or air

  3. [verb] become constricted; "The hernia will strangulate"


